Sector Rotation Strategies with S&P 500 ETFs
Sector rotation is a dynamic investment tactic where investors shift their allocations among different industries of the stock market based on prevailing economic conditions and performance trends. Traders employing this strategy aim to capitalize on cyclical shifts within the S&P 500, a benchmark index tracking the performance of 500 large-cap U.S. companies.
